Output 2d2cc23b6fdfe142da2aa8716075400b5498a597b5b79291d482dce2c532e7e2:0

value
298759131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714f1065ce6fdaebbef3e9c791e90acd3150ab69 OP_EQUAL
address
3C28zgpSFTP65MqmQ4FR4wPdfEwdsnekkd
transaction
2d2cc23b6fdfe142da2aa8716075400b5498a597b5b79291d482dce2c532e7e2
confirmations
338552
spent
true